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Clicking "Save" on Create Community/Collection should provide user feedback #2941

Closed
tdonohue opened this issue Apr 15, 2024 · 1 comment · Fixed by #2980
Closed

Clicking "Save" on Create Community/Collection should provide user feedback #2941

tdonohue opened this issue Apr 15, 2024 · 1 comment · Fixed by #2980
Assignees
Labels
bug claimed: Atmire Atmire team is working on this issue & will contribute back component: Collection Collection display or editing component: Community Community display or editing testathon Reported by a tester during Community Testathon usability
Milestone

Comments

@tdonohue
Copy link
Member

Describe the bug
If you Create a new Community or Collection, clicking "Save" appears to do nothing. It's unclear if you've clicked the button or if the backend is processing. This is semi-related to #2914

To Reproduce
Steps to reproduce the behavior:

  1. Create a new Community or Collection via "New -> Community" or "New -> Collection"
    • NOTE: This is most visible on https://sandbox.dspace.org when creating a new Collection, as this action may take 5-10 seconds to complete.
  2. Fill out metadata
  3. Click Save. Notice the button remains enabled & it may not even be clear that you pressed the button.

Expected behavior
Some visual feedback should be given to the user. Either the button should disable (like the submission form behavior) or some sort of "Processing.." message should appear or similar.

Related work
Semi-related to #2914. Because Collection creation can take >2 seconds, it's important to give the user feedback.

@tdonohue tdonohue added bug help wanted Needs a volunteer to claim to move forward component: Community Community display or editing component: Collection Collection display or editing testathon Reported by a tester during Community Testathon labels Apr 15, 2024
@tdonohue tdonohue added this to the 8.0 milestone Apr 15, 2024
@artlowel
Copy link
Member

@tdonohue We can work on this

@artlowel artlowel added claimed: Atmire Atmire team is working on this issue & will contribute back and removed help wanted Needs a volunteer to claim to move forward labels Apr 19, 2024
@artlowel artlowel self-assigned this Apr 19,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
bug claimed: Atmire Atmire team is working on this issue & will contribute back component: Collection Collection display or editing component: Community Community display or editing testathon Reported by a tester during Community Testathon usability
Projects
Status: ✅ Done
Development

Successfully merging a pull request may close this issue.

2 participants